API Security Tester MCP Server

smithery badge An MCP server that provides tools for comprehensive API security testing and analysis.

Features

  • Comprehensive API endpoint security testing
  • JavaScript file analysis for endpoints and sensitive information
  • Historical endpoint discovery
  • Subdomain scanning
  • API fuzzing capabilities
  • GraphQL security testing
  • TLS configuration analysis
  • Rate limiting detection
  • JWT token analysis
  • Security headers validation
  • CORS configuration checking

Available Tools

test-endpoint

Test an API endpoint for various security concerns:

{
  url: string;
  method: string;
  headers?: Record<string, string>;
  body?: string;
  isGraphQL?: boolean;
  performanceTest?: boolean;
  performanceTestDuration?: number;
  validateSchema?: boolean;
  scanDocs?: boolean;
  reverseEngineer?: boolean;
  crawlDepth?: number;
}

extract-js

Extract JavaScript files from a domain:

{
  domain: string;
  recursive?: boolean;
}

analyze-js

Analyze JavaScript files for endpoints and sensitive information:

{
  url: string;
}

historical-endpoints

Discover historical endpoints from various sources:

{
  domain: string;
  sources?: string[]; // ['wayback', 'commoncrawl', 'alienvault']
}

subdomain-scan

Discover subdomains using various techniques:

{
  domain: string;
  techniques?: string[]; // ['dns', 'certificates', 'archives']
}

fuzzing-scan

Perform fuzzing tests on endpoints:

{
  url: string;
  wordlist: string; // 'common', 'api', 'security', 'full'
  concurrent?: number;
}
